Home prices hit record high in May as sales stall
How much did the median price of an existing home increase year over year?
The median price of an existing home increased by 5.8% year over year, reaching a record-high of $419,300 in May. This gain was the strongest since October 2022, with prices rising in all regions.

What is the current annualized rate of existing home sales?
The current annualized rate of existing home sales is 4.11 million units, as of May 2024. This figure is based on closed sales, which likely reflects contracts signed in March and April. The sales pace remained relatively flat compared to the previous month and marked a 2.8% decrease from May of last year.
